Communication and Sexual Posture: The Key to Greater Relationship Fulfillment
In any romantic relationship, effective communication is crucial for fostering intimacy and understanding. It forms the foundation upon which partners build their emotional and physical connections. However, there is often a disconnect between what partners hope to convey and how their messages are interpreted. To bridge this gap, it is essential to develop effective marital communication techniques, particularly regarding intimate topics like sexual posture.
One of the most significant aspects of communication in a relationship is being open and honest about desires, needs, and boundaries. Many couples shy away from discussing their sexual preferences, fearing judgment or rejection. Nonetheless, approaching the topic with sensitivity can lead to deeper intimacy. It is valuable to create a safe space where both partners feel comfortable sharing their thoughts and feelings. Initiating the conversation with “I feel” statements can be very effective. For example, saying I feel more connected to you when we try different things together shifts the focus from blame or expectation to sharing personal experiences.
In addition to verbal communication, non-verbal cues play an important role in expressing desires and comfort levels. Body language, touch, and even selected sexual postures can communicate vital information. Understanding the significance of different postures can enhance both physical pleasure and emotional connection. For instance, positions that allow for face-to-face contact can increase intimacy, while those that support a feeling of security can build trust. As partners explore their physical connection, discussing what feels good or what feels uncomfortable can lead to a richer sexual experience.

Moreover, the concept of sexual posture extends beyond the physical realm. It also encompasses the emotional stance one takes in a relationship. A positive sexual posture means being open-minded, eager to learn, and willing to explore. This involves understanding that each partner has different needs and preferences and approaching those with curiosity rather than judgment. By adopting a mindset of exploration, couples can discover new dimensions of their relationship, enhancing both their emotional and physical bonds.
Its important to recognize that effective communication is not just about expressing desires but also about active listening. All too often, one partner may dominate the conversation while the other feels unheard. Practicing reflective listening can address this imbalance. This involves repeating back what the other person has said to demonstrate understanding and validation. Phrases like What I hear you saying is… can clarify that both partners are on the same page and foster a stronger emotional connection.
